Building Long-Term NFT Credibility
1. What Is Organic NFT Promotion?
Organic promotion means generating traffic and engagement without directly paying for ads. Think of SEO, social media presence, community building on Discord or Telegram, and content-driven storytelling.
The beauty of organic growth lies in trust. NFT buyers often research heavily before minting or investing. A project that consistently posts updates, writes thoughtful blogs, or engages in communities is perceived as more authentic.
2. Why Organic Works
- Authenticity: The audience sees consistent effort, not just ad-driven noise.
 - Longevity: Content stays visible for months or even years.
 - Community Strength: A strong, organically grown community can become your best marketing channel.
 
For example, projects that post regular updates on X (formerly Twitter), Medium, or Reddit tend to convert more effectively during their launch phase — because followers already believe in their story.
Paid Advertising: Scaling Fast and Targeting Precisely
1. What Paid Advertising Means for NFT Projects
Paid NFT advertising involves using platforms Google Ads, or crypto-friendly ad networks to reach highly targeted audiences. These are users actively searching for NFT drops, crypto opportunities, or blockchain content.
Paid ads let you push your project directly in front of ideal buyers — quickly and strategically. This is especially crucial when mint dates are approaching or when your collection needs traction in a limited window.
2. Why Paid Advertising Works
- Instant Visibility: No waiting months for SEO to pick up.
 - Audience Targeting: Focus on NFT enthusiasts, crypto investors, and digital art collectors.
 - Scalable Reach: More budget equals more impressions — measurable and predictable.
 
When done right, paid campaigns can complement your organic efforts by driving initial traffic that feeds long-term engagement.

The Smart Mix of Organic and Paid NFT Advertising
Smart NFT advertisers no longer view organic and paid promotion as separate worlds. Instead, they combine them in stages.
Stage 1: Pre-Launch (Organic Focus)
Before your NFT drop, the goal is awareness. Build a community, share teasers, and publish consistent updates. Organic content helps form emotional attachment.
Stage 2: Launch (Paid Boost)
When your mint goes live, visibility matters more than ever. Paid campaigns can target keywords, platforms, and geographies that drive real buyers to your mint page.
Stage 3: Post-Launch (Retarget and Retain)
After launch, keep engagement alive with retargeting ads, community AMAs, and exclusive rewards. This keeps your NFT holders active and loyal.
Why Many NFT Projects Fail to Gain Momentum
Here’s the harsh truth — many NFT projects never reach their potential because they skip strategic planning. They either over-invest in ads without building a community or rely too much on organic posting without visibility.
This imbalance leads to inconsistent reach, poor engagement, and wasted ad spend. The best projects take a data-driven approach, analyzing metrics like cost per acquisition (CPA), click-through rate (CTR), and engagement levels before scaling.
